OPERATIONAL PERFORMANCE (continued)
Activation:
Manual - push button (recommended)
Automatic - by immersion in water (as a backup, if set ON)
H2O graphic indicates Wet Contacts are bridged (unit must be dried prior to transport or storage).
Cannot be manually activated deeper than 4 feet (1.2 meters), if the Water Activation feature is set OFF.
Cannot be activated at elevations higher than 14,000 feet (4,267 meters)
Shutoff:
Automatically shuts off if no dive is made within 120 minutes after initial activation. Reactivation required.
Automatically shuts off 24 hours after last dive (will reactivate if the H2O graphic is displayed).
Cannot be shut off manually.
Setting FO2:
Automatically set for 'Air' upon activation
Remains set for Air unless an FO2 numerical value is set
Nitrox set points from 21 to 50 %
If set for 21%, remains set for 21% until changed
If set for >21%, it reverts to 50% 10 minutes after the dive, if the FO2 Default is ON. If the FO2 Default is OFF, the value will re-
main at the value set.
Operating Temperature:
The ATMOS 2 will operate in almost any temperature diving environment in the world, between 32 °F and 140 °F (0 and 60
°C). At extremely low temperatures, the LCD may become sluggish, but this will not affect it's accuracy. If stored or trans-
ported in extremely low temperature areas (below freezing), you should warm the module and its battery with body heat before
diving.
